风量罩测量误差原因及基于静压补偿法的研究  被引量:4

Research on Causes of Measurement Errors of Air Volume Hood and Correction Method based on Static Pressure Compensation

摘  要:风量罩广泛应用于暖通空调行业,但在测量过程中存在测量结果不准确的问题。通过实验发现,风量罩罩体对系统出风口产生静压作用,阻碍其自然出风。因此提出一种基于静压补偿的方法,在风量罩内安装小型风扇,将出风口处存在的静压降低至0 Pa,使得风量罩测得的风量大小准确无误,并在标准风洞实验室内证实了这一方法的可行性。The air volume cover is widely used in the HVAC industry,but there is a problem of inaccurate measurement results during the measurement process.Through experiments,it was found that the air volume cover has a static pressure effect on the air outlet of the system,which hinders its natural wind.Therefore,a method based on static pressure compensation is proposed,and a small fan is installed in the air volume cover to reduce the static pressure existing at the air outlet to 0 Pa,so that the air volume measured by the air volume cover is accurate.And confirmed the feasibility of this method in the standard wind tunnel laboratory.
